Block
#13,546,009
2w
11 txs60,148 confs
Transactions
11
Total Output
₳183,502.42
$26.84K
Fees
₳3.39
Size
11.88 KB
12,164 bytes
Details
Hash
de143d3db76492c2ba2ba841e357835cc8b31084e459fa185067ac62d81cabaf
Epoch / Slot
Epoch 636 · slot 189,815,348 · epoch-slot 426,548
Timestamp
2w · Sat, 13 Jun 2026 20:13:59 GMT
Block producer
VRF key
vrf_vk1h…psl4umdp
Op cert
f8a0477c…2f9c0013
Op cert counter
24